厦门海洋环境预报台,作为我国海洋气象预报的重要机构,承担着为海上船舶、渔业生产、海上旅游等提供准确海洋天气服务的重任。在这篇文章中,我们将揭开厦门海洋环境预报台如何准确预测海洋天气的神秘面纱,以及这项工作对于海上安全与航行的重要性。
海洋天气预报的重要性
海洋天气预报对于海上活动至关重要。它不仅关系到船舶的航行安全,还影响到渔业生产、海上旅游等多个领域。准确的海洋天气预报可以帮助渔民选择合适的出海时机,减少航行风险,确保人命财产安全。
海洋天气预报的原理
海洋天气预报的原理与陆地天气预报类似,都是基于大气动力学、海洋学、气象学等学科的原理。具体来说,主要包括以下几个步骤:
1. 数据收集
厦门海洋环境预报台通过卫星遥感、浮标观测、船舶报告、岸站观测等多种手段收集海洋气象数据。这些数据包括海洋表面温度、风速、风向、海浪、潮汐等。
# 示例代码:模拟海洋气象数据收集
data = {
'surface_temperature': [25, 26, 24],
'wind_speed': [10, 15, 8],
'wind_direction': ['东南', '东北', '西南'],
'wave_height': [1.2, 1.5, 0.8],
'tide_level': [3, 2, 4]
}
2. 数据处理
收集到的海洋气象数据需要经过预处理、校正和插值等处理步骤,以提高数据的准确性和可靠性。
# 示例代码:模拟数据处理
def process_data(data):
# 数据预处理
processed_data = {}
for key, value in data.items():
# 校正和插值
processed_data[key] = correct_and_interpolate(value)
return processed_data
# 模拟数据处理函数
def correct_and_interpolate(data):
# 校正和插值算法
pass
processed_data = process_data(data)
3. 模型计算
基于收集到的处理后的数据,预报员会运用数值模式进行计算,以预测未来的海洋天气状况。目前,我国主要采用全球海洋数值模式和区域海洋数值模式。
# 示例代码:模拟数值模式计算
def model_computation(processed_data):
# 模式计算
result = {}
for key, value in processed_data.items():
result[key] = model(key, value)
return result
def model(key, value):
# 模式计算算法
pass
result = model_computation(processed_data)
4. 预报发布
根据计算结果,预报员会对未来的海洋天气状况进行预测,并将预报结果发布给相关部门和公众。
海洋天气预报的应用
海洋天气预报在实际应用中具有广泛的影响。以下列举几个典型案例:
1. 航运业
海洋天气预报为船舶提供航行安全保障,避免因恶劣天气导致的船只事故。
2. 渔业生产
海洋天气预报帮助渔民选择合适的出海时机,提高捕鱼产量。
3. 海上旅游
海洋天气预报为海上旅游活动提供安全保障,促进旅游业发展。
总结
厦门海洋环境预报台在海洋天气预报方面积累了丰富的经验,为海上安全与航行提供了有力保障。通过不断改进技术、完善预报体系,厦门海洋环境预报台将继续为我国海洋事业发展贡献力量。
